Orient designs have also become another trend for the fall. Kimono like jackers, obi
belts, and more are embroidered with cranes and other sleek orient techniques.
Layering is finally coming back, why wear one piece when you can wear several.
Pairing skirts with pants is the newest trends and has been seen on the runways from
designers like Chanel, Louis Vuitton, Marc Jacobs, and Prada.
